Instalacion, configuracio y marco de trabajo con Heroku

Instalacion y configuracion de Heroku Preliminar En vista de que utilizando otros sistemas para hacer deploy resultaba un atraso al estar concentrados mucho tiempo en tareas de devops. Por lo que se decidio usar la herramienta Heroku el cual puede encontrar mas informacion Aqui Asi mismo si no esta registrado en heroku debera crear la cuenta. Enlaces de interes Instalacion Deploy de aplicaciones nodejs El lider inmediato debe tener conocimiento si usted esta agregado al Team de heroku, lo mas prudente es comunicarle para que sea agregado. Si su lider inmediato crea un repositorio nuevo de github para un proyecto en particular, y el mismo no tiene un espacio de deploy en heroku ustede debe realizar lo siguiente: Loguearse en heroku y realizar lo que indica el siguiente gif: https://drive.google.com/file/d/1FWsHS_bBapi6wNO9iov9nsmT7d96Ay6o/view Debe agregar al proyecto en el directorio raiz un archivo llamado Procfile el cual debe contener lo siguiente: bach web: npm start Siempre verifique que en el package.json en el apartado de la propiedad main este el archivo a ejecutar. En la pantalla final se menciona que debe hacer push de todos sus cambios a su rama en github para luego hacer deploy. Importante: Debe enlazar el proyecto en local con el proyecto heroku, para ello debe ejecutar el siguiente comando: heroku git:clone -a myapp donde myapp es el nombre de la app que ha creado en heroku. Si ha realizado mas cambios, haga push de ellos en github, o bien puede hacer el deploy, ejecute el comando git push heroku master y el deploy empezara a realizarce. Si no presento errores puede ejecutar heroku open y podra ver la aplicacion funcionando. Si el proyecto ya posee un espacio en heroku y usted desea hacer deploy de sus cambios debe ejecutar el siguiente comando heroku git:remote -a myapp en donde myapp sera el nombre del app del espacio reservado en heroku, el lider inmediato debe proveerle dicho nombre. Luego realice los pasos 5 y 6 anteriormente descrito.